The Nagasaki Longfin is a Boats vehicle in GTA Online, available from DockTease for FREE, known for its versatility and value.

Excellent value for money. Strong performance at a reasonable price.
The Nagasaki Longfin costs FREE. It achieves a top speed with a top speed of 85 mph (136.8 km/h). Solid all-rounder suitable for most players. According to community testing methodology by Broughy1322.
| Price | FREE |
|---|---|
| Top Speed | 85 mph (136.8 km/h) |
| Manufacturer | Nagasaki |
| Category | Boats |
"A fast patrol boat used in the Cayo Perico Heist."

Shitzu Police Predator
The Police Predator is a weaponized patrol boat added in Agents of Sabotage. Initially free during the launch event, now available from Warstock.
Kraken
The Kraken is a personal submarine allowing underwater exploration of GTA Online's ocean. Originally a returning player bonus, it's now free for all players from DockTease. Essential for underwater collectibles and exploration.
